This is not new, but while reviewing some of the 'disk full' messages resulting 
from one of the long-running system tests, I realized that the text of ERROR 
XSLA4 could be read, by people unfamiliar with derby and brave or in a panic, 
as suggesting one to delete parts of the log directory:

"ERROR XSLA4: Cannot write to the log, most likely the log is full.  Please 
delete unnecessary files.  It is also possible that the file system is read 
only, or the disk has failed, or some other problems with the media."

We've been fighting people deleting files from the log directory, and even if 
this message text may not be the culprit, it certainly is open for 
misinterpretation.

I think we need to change this message. 
English language experts and native as well as non-native speakers are 
particularly invited to chime in.

One suggestion is:
Error encountered when attempting to write the transaction recovery log.  Most 
likely the disk holding the recovery log is full.  If the disk is full, the 
only way to proceed is to free up space on the disk by either expanding it or 
deleting files not related to Derby.  It is also possible that the file system 
and/or disk where the Derby transaction log resides is read only.  The error 
can also be encountered if the disk or filesystem has failed.
